The reality is the opposite - if it's not in writing then the PMC doesn't have to provide the service or can charge extra for it.We have a 12 page management contract that we've added our real experiences to over the years, with the intent of protecting both us AND the landlord.

Utilizing the preREO strategy, a receiver (i.e. a local real estate agent or property manager who you may already have a relationship with) could be appointed to make repairs and rent out the home during the foreclosure process.
